  • Ensure accountability, transparency, cross-functionally and effective communication within the EHS Department while ensuring that information is timely, clear and accurate.
  • Investigate and prepare required reports of EHS system performance including but not limited to investigation reports, injury reports, insurance claims, performance metric reports, etc.
  • Take necessary steps to ensure a safe work environment for all employees.
  • Participate in the investigation of incidents, near misses and property damage incidents.
  • Ensure follow-up is done to minimize future exposure and proper records/documents are maintained.
  • Conduct, coordinate and track various training to support company programs.
  • Perform safety audits and inspections to ensure compliance with regulatory agencies, company environmental, health, and safety policies, quality procedures and practices.
  • Maintain internal and regulatory reporting including data collection and reporting including but not limited to air, storm water and surface water discharge.
  • Ensure the company meets all its legislative compliance obligations with OSHA, CAL/OSHA, EPA, AQMD, ADA, and fire codes.
  • Serve as primary contact for all regulatory agencies for inspections, permitting, reporting (air, water, waste).
  • Maintain compliance with permits, government regulations and other industry practices.
  • Keep abreast of any safety and environmental law or regulation changes that impact the client.
  • Participate in manufacturing meetings to discuss workplace safety and regulatory concerns and opportunities.
  • Actively role model all company and assigned client environmental, health and safety standards.
  • Establish and maintain effective relationships with Operations, Managers, Supervisors and employees.
  • Assist in the oversight of the Worker’s Compensation program.
  • Promote excellent relationship with MENTOR clients, encouraging an open dialog and trustful communication between both parties demonstrating a professional conduct at all times and proudly represent MTG at all levels and places.
  • Alerts management when problems are identified and make recommendations for improvements.
  • Must be a team player committed to developing and working in a quality environment.
  • Complies with MENTOR’s administrative requirements timely and consistently in areas such as: weekly reports, updating of CV’s, yearly updates of medical/training records, attendance to work, etc.
  • Other duties and participation on special projects as required or assigned by manager, upper management or by the client.

Physical Requirements and Working Environment:
  • While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to use hands to finger, handle, feel, or operate equipments, tools, or controls. The employee frequently is required to stand, walk, talk, or hear; sit; climb or balance, stoop, kneel, crouch or crawl; and smell. The employee may lift and/or move up to 25-35 pounds and occasionally lift and/or move up to 50 p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, depth perception, and the ability to adjust focus.
  • He / she may frequently work inside weather conditions, near moving mechanical parts, exposed to wet and or humid conditions, and an odorous atmosphere, may be exposed to fumes and the risk of electrical shock ,and occasionally work on ladders in high places, in small spaces, such as lift/metering stations, manholes, tanks and wet wells. The noise level in the work environment is usually moderately loud.
